Câu hỏi phỏng vấn SQL
Câu hỏi

Khóa chính (PRIMARY KEY) trong SQL là gì?

Câu trả lời

Khóa chính (PRIMARY KEY) trong SQL là một ràng buộc được sử dụng trong các bảng cơ sở dữ liệu để đảm bảo tính duy nhất của mỗi bản ghi trong bảng đó. Mỗi bảng chỉ có thể có một khóa chính, và khóa chính này có thể bao gồm một hoặc nhiều cột. Các giá trị trong cột hoặc các cột của khóa chính không được phép trùng lặp và không được phép là giá trị NULL.

Đặc điểm chính của khóa chính

  • Duy nhất: Không có hai hàng nào trong bảng có thể có giá trị khóa chính giống nhau.
  • Không Null: Không cho phép giá trị NULL trong cột khóa chính.
  • Tối ưu hóa truy vấn: Các cột trong khóa chính thường được sử dụng trong các thao tác truy vấn và chỉ mục, giúp cải thiện hiệu suất truy ...
junior

junior

Gợi ý câu hỏi phỏng vấn

middle

Hash index hoạt động như thế nào trong SQL?

expert

Liệt kê một số nhược điểm của Hash Index trong SQL?

middle

Collation trong SQL là gì?

Bình luận

Chưa có bình luận nào

Chưa có bình luận nào